A groundbreaking audiobook adaptation of Homer’s The Odyssey has been launched, featuring an AI-generated rendition of Michael Caine’s voice. This 13-hour production utilizes artificial intelligence to simulate the iconic voice of the esteemed actor, alongside other digital performances, in a bid to attract a contemporary audience through innovative technology. The project, developed with Caine’s approval, integrates AI narration with multiple voices, music, and cinematic sound design, thereby preserving the essence of traditional storytelling.
The introduction of AI-generated voices in the audiobook industry has ignited discussions within Hollywood, where actors and creators express concerns about the potential repercussions of artificial intelligence on creative professions. Advocates, however, argue that AI voice technology, when used with the consent of performers, can enhance storytelling possibilities and provide fresh options for narrative expression.
This release coincides with the anticipation surrounding Christopher Nolan’s forthcoming film adaptation of The Odyssey. Although Michael Caine is not involved in the movie, he shares a long-standing collaboration with Nolan, having appeared in several of the director’s notable films, such as Inception, Interstellar, The Prestige, and The Dark Knight trilogy.
Nolan’s film adaptation boasts an impressive cast, including renowned actors Matt Damon, Anne Hathaway, Tom Holland, Zendaya, and Robert Pattinson, among others. This star-studded lineup contributes to the film’s status as one of the most eagerly awaited cinematic interpretations of the classic Greek epic.
